Abstract
Based on a data sample of decays collected with the BESIII experiment, a search for the flavor changing neutral current transition is performed for the first time. No signal candidates are observed and the upper limit on the branching fraction of is determined to be at the 90% confidence level. The result is consistent with expectations from the standard model, and no evidence for new physics is found.
